<ul lang="8vndncc"></ul><bdo dropzone="el33cmt"></bdo><time dir="iar_6yg"></time><ul dropzone="bo3vqmq"></ul><del dir="jlfqm5n"></del><ol dir="39ruc4r"></ol><noframes lang="skqleu6">
            
                    

            随着数字货币的迅速崛起,越来越多的人开始关注其底层技术,这不仅是数字货币的根基,更是推动其发展的动力。本文将深入探讨数字货币的底层技术,包括区块链技术、智能合约、加密算法、共识机制等,带您全面了解数字货币背后的技术支撑。

            一、区块链技术:去中心化的信任基石

            区块链技术是数字货币的核心底层技术之一。它的基本特征是去中心化和不可篡改,使数字货币能够在没有中心化机构的情况下实现可信的交易。在区块链中,所有的交易记录都被分布式保存于网络中的各个节点,任何节点都无法单独控制整条链。

            区块链分为公有链、私有链和联盟链三种类型。公有链是开放的,任何人都可以参与到网络中,如比特币和以太坊;私有链则是封闭的,仅限特定用户使用,适用于企业内部;联盟链是一种介于公有链和私有链之间的结构,由多个组织共同维护。

            区块链的不可篡改性源于其数据结构,数据以区块的形式进行存储,每个区块中包含前一个区块的哈希值,任何对已存在区块的修改都会导致后续所有区块的哈希值变化,因此修改几乎是不可能的。

            二、智能合约:自动执行的协议

            智能合约是一种自执行的数字合约,其中条款由代码和区块链技术达成自动化执行。它使得数字货币不仅限于转账交易,还能在更复杂的场景中发挥作用。以太坊的成功很大程度上归功于其支持的智能合约功能,使得开发者可以在其区块链上创建去中心化应用(DApps)。

            智能合约的优势在于无需通过中介进行交易,从而降低了交易成本和时间。例如,在保险领域,可以通过智能合约来自动判定赔付条件,当条件被满足时,合同会自动执行,无需人工介入。

            然而,智能合约的安全性也是一个需要关注的问题。如果合约代码存在漏洞,黑客有可能 exploit 利用漏洞进行攻击。此时,智能合约的自动化执行反而可能导致资金的损失。

            三、加密算法:数据安全的保障

            加密算法在数字货币系统中扮演了至关重要的角色,它确保了交易交易的安全性、用户的隐私性以及网络的整体安全。数字货币主要使用公钥加密和哈希函数两种加密方式。

            公钥加密通过一对密钥(公钥和私钥)来实现用户身份的认证和交易的安全。公钥是公开的,可以任意分享,私钥则必须绝对保密,用于签署交易。哈希函数用于将任意长度的数据转换为固定长度的字符串,常用于生成区块链中的区块哈希避免数据篡改。

            虽然加密算法为数字货币提供了安全防护,但它也不是绝对安全的。随着计算能力的提高,尤其是量子计算的发展,现有的加密算法可能面临安全风险。因此,面对未来的威胁,研究人员正在探索更先进的加密技术。

            四、共识机制:保障网络一致性的核心

            共识机制是区块链网络中确定交易有效性和状态的协议,是数字货币底层技术的另一个关键组成部分。它确保网络中所有节点都达成一致,避免了双重支付问题。

            目前,常见的共识机制有工作量证明(PoW)、持有量证明(PoS)等。工作量证明是比特币采用的机制,要求矿工通过消耗计算资源来验证交易;而持有量证明则是通过持有数字货币的数量来决定参与验证的权利,从而提高了能源效率。

            共识机制的选择会在很大程度上影响数字货币的性能与安全性。虽然PoW在安全性上表现较好,但它的能耗问题引发了广泛关注,而PoS则在绿色环保上更具优势,但其去中心化的程度依然存在争议。

            五、相关问题探讨

            数字货币未来的发展方向是什么?

            随着金融科技的迅速发展,数字货币的未来充满了可能性。在众多因素的影响下,数字货币的发展方向可分为几个主要领域。

            首先,合规化将是数字货币未来的重要趋势。各国政府对数字货币的监管政策不断完善,合规化将有助于数字货币的广泛接受和应用。通过合规化,用户的投资安全性将得到提升,市场也会更加稳定。

            其次,数字货币在金融服务中的应用将日渐深入。随着DeFi(去中心化金融)浪潮的到来,数字货币不再局限于单一的支付功能,更加多样化的金融产品将不断推出,如借贷、保险、资产管理等。

            最后,跨链技术的发展也将为数字货币的未来带来更大的可能性。跨链技术旨在实现不同区块链之间的相互操作与交互,打破不同数字货币之间的壁垒,成本更低、时间更快地进行交易。

            数字货币在全球经济中的影响力有多大?

            数字货币的崛起正在不断改变全球经济格局,影响力逐渐显现。首先,数字货币有助于提高金融服务的普及度。许多发展中国家由于传统银行服务不普及,导致其中部分群体无法获得金融服务。数字货币及其相关技术为这些人群提供了便捷的金融解决方案。

            其次,数字货币促进了国际贸易的便利。通过区块链技术,国际交易的透明度极大提高,交易成本降低。这为跨国企业的支付流程提供了新的选择,使得国际贸易变得更加高效。

            此外,数字货币的兴起可能导致传统金融体系的转型。在许多金融交易中,数字货币作为中介的角色将逐渐取代传统金融工具,迫使金融机构改革其服务模式,提升其竞争力。

            如何确保数字货币的安全性?

            在数字货币日益普及的背景下,安全性问题显得尤为重要。首先,用户个人的安全意识需加强。许多数字货币盗窃事件的发生是由于用户私钥的泄露和 phishing 攻击。因此,用户在使用数字货币时,必须妥善保管个人密钥,避免在不安全的环境中进行交易。

            其次,区块链网络安全也不容忽视。随着数字货币的增多,黑客对区块链技术的攻击方式也日益多样化。矿池、交易所等中心化平台容易成为攻击目标,因此选择信任度高或经过安全审计的平台非常重要。

            此外,未来的密码学技术发展对于提高数字货币的安全性也至关重要。量子计算的发展可能对现有的加密算法形成威胁,因此开发新的抗量子密码学技术将成为保护数字货币安全的重要研究方向。

            总结而言,数字货币的底层技术是一个复杂而广泛的领域,其持续发展将对经济、金融、科技等多个领域产生深远影响。通过深入了解这些底层技术,用户能够更好地把握数字货币的未来趋势和发展潜力。